Citroen updates best-selling Berlingo van

image preview

Citroen’s best-selling light commercial vehicle (LCV), the Berlingo, has been updated. This popular LCV now benefits from further fuel economy improvements and emissions reductions as well as being refreshed with exterior changes, a new gearbox, and more in-cab storage.

Citroen C4 Picasso crowned Continental Irish Car of the Year 2014

image preview

The Citroen C4 Picasso has been voted Continental Irish Car of the Year for 2014 by the members of the Irish Motoring Writers Association. The winner was revealed at an awards ceremony in Dublin last week, in front of an audience largely made up of motor industry representatives.

New Citroen C4 MPV - the best Picasso ever

image preview

Citroen has just launched their new C4 Picasso and the latest incarnation in a bold tradition is again an innovative MPV. In fact the Xsara Picasso in 1999 was the first and thousands have been sold in Ireland in the interim. And the latest C4 Picasso is indeed a true expression of Citroën’s Créative Technologie.
